Output 40c634209213164b8cec392495eaf8b994998c043b2f47dd04f0e220e6534608:1

value
588888
script pubkey
OP_0 OP_PUSHBYTES_20 2efe9a2d8a817bb0e942d30ec838b1794334e66a
address
bc1q9mlf5tv2s9amp62z6v8vsw9309pnfen2ltdh8t
transaction
40c634209213164b8cec392495eaf8b994998c043b2f47dd04f0e220e6534608
spent
true